Step by step process of observing the fast

Grahan Vrat also known as Eclipse Fasting is a traditional practice followed by many people in India. The process of observing this fast involves several steps: 1. Before the eclipse begins take a bath & wear clean clothes. 2. Begin the fast at least 12 hours before the eclipse starts. 3. During the fast avoid eating or drinking anything. 4. Chant mantras or prayers dedicated to Lord Vishnu or Shiva. 5. Avoid looking directly at the eclipse as this is believed to be harmful. 6. After the eclipse ends break your fast by consuming a simple meal. 7. Offer prayers & seek blessings for good health & prosperity. Following these steps will help you observe the Grahan Vrat in a traditional & respectful manner.

Planets or nakshatras associated with this fast

Grahan Vrat also known as Eclipse Fasting is a traditional practice followed by many Hindus. This fast is observed during solar or lunar eclipses to ward off negative energies. The planets associated with this fast are Rahu & Ketu which are known as the shadow planets. These planets are believed to have a strong impact during eclipses & fasting during this time is said to bring spiritual benefits. Also certain nakshatras like Magha Purva Phalguni & Purva Ashadha are also considered better for observing Grahan Vrat. Ancient stories legends or Puranic references

Grahan Vrat also known as Eclipse Fasting is a traditional practice followed in Hindu culture. According to ancient stories & legends this is believed that during a solar or lunar eclipse negative energies are at their peak. To protect oneself from these harmful energies people observe fasting & perform rituals. Puranic references mention that demons like Rahu & Ketu are said to swallow the sun & moon during eclipses causing darkness & disruption. By fasting & praying during this time individuals seek protection & blessings from the divine forces to ward off any negative impacts.
